操作系统课程设计报告模拟进程调度程序
(一)此设计报告是对操作系统中进程调度的两种算法,即静态优先权调度算法和需要时间片的转法进行了描述,并分析了它们的工作机理。最高优先权调度算法的基本思想是把
CPU分配给就绪队列中优先权最高的进程。静态优先数是在创建进程时确定的,并在整个进程运行期间不再改变。简单轮转法的基本思想是:所有就绪进程按
FCFS
排成一个队列,总是把处理机分配给队首的进程,各进程占用
CPU的时间片相同。如果运行进程用完它的时间片后还未完成,就把它送回到就绪队列的末尾,把处理机重新分配给队首的进程,直至所有的进程运行完毕。然后用具体语言模拟了
一个进程调度的程序。用户可以自己输入产生进程,然后选择调度方式进行调度。所用的语言为
VisualBasic.Net
,结果显示了调度运行过程。
问题描述和分析………………………………………………
4算法设计……………………………………………………
5源代码及说明…………………………………………………
5结果与分析………………………………………………………
17参考文献………………………………………………………
18一、问题描述和 ...
附件列表